The already leaked LG’s phone is now official. LG G3 Beat, or LG G3s or LG G3 Mini, is the first LG’s device which packs most of the great features of LG G3 in a more compact package. The thin bezels, the overall design, the simple yet perfect user interface and the fast Laser Auto Focus technology are the features you can find on both the LG G3 and the LG G3 Beat. But on the other side, the screen size is smaller with less quality, the processing power is weaker and the battery capacity is lower.

LG G3 Beat General Specifications:

  • 137.7 x 69.6 x 10.3mm, 134g
  • 5.0-inch HD IPS, 1280 x 720, 294ppi
  • 1GB of RAM, 8GB of internal memory, MicroSD card support
  • 8MP / 1.3MP Main and Front cameras, with Laser Auto Foucs
  • 1.2 GHz Quad-Core Snapdragon 400 processor
  • Android 4.4.2 KitKat
  • Wi-Fi b/g/n, Bluetooth 4.0, NFC, 4G LTE
  • 2,540 mAh removable battery
  • Colors: Metallic Black, Silk White, Shine Gold

The LG G3 Beat is using the same exact LG G3’s design language and considering the fact that we are dealing with a mid-range device, the design looks awesome and unique, and the thin bezels are just eye catching. When it comes to the screen size, we believe a 5-inch is enough for a smartphone but the 720p screen resolution can be kind of a deal breaker. But keep in mind that LG G3 Beat is aiming at the mid-range smartphone class.

Let’s get under hood where the quad-core Snapdragon 400 processor clocked at 1.2GHz is responsible to power-up the device along with 1GB of RAM and the reasonable 2,540 removable battery.

When LG announced the LG G3, the Korean were very confident about the device’s camera as it was equipped with a unique technology called Laser Auto Focus, which could take shots faster than ever by measuring the distance using a laser beam. And the good news is that the LG G3 Beat is also coming with this innovative technology which means faster shots without losing the quality.

When it comes to the Software, the Android 4.4.2 KitKat is pre-installed and LG has managed to equip the LG G3 Beat with some of LG G3’s great software features including Touch & Shoot, Gesture Shot, Smart Keyboard and QuickMemo+.

You are now wondering about the LG G3 Beat Price and Availability, aren’t you?
Well, like the LG G3, the little brother will be first available in South Korea starting from July 18 and then the wider roll-out begins in Europe and the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) countries. Unfortunately LG has not yet announced any price for the LG G3 Beat, but since LG wants to get some fair market share in the mid-range class the price shouldn’t be any higher than the current device in such category. Update: Price Confirmed in Europe
While LG Beat will be shipped to the Europe after its debut in South Korea and will be called LG G3 s, the official LG blog in Germany announced the €349 price tag for the second member of LG G3 family. This price means that G3 s will be sold about €120 cheaper than the LG G3 with 16GB of internal storage and 2GB of RAM.
